From organoid culture to manufacturing: technologies for reproducible and scalable organoid production

Abstract

In this review, we systematically categorize diverse organoid engineering strategies-including cellular programming, material engineering, and platform- or system-level innovations-according to their impact on reproducibility and scalability, and highlight representative applications and emerging directions. By reframing organoid generation as a manufacturing process, these technological advances pave the way toward standardized and high-fidelity organoid production for both fundamental research and translational applications.
